Responsibility for the provision of air traffic services within international airspace is delegated to United Nations member states by the International Civil Aviation Organisation (ICAO). ICAO divides such airspace into flight information regions, parts of which may be deemed controlled airspace and, where appropriate, classified as an Oceanic Control Area. WebbIf pilots have not received their Oceanic Clearance prior to reaching the Shanwick OCA boundary, ... An example of an inflight voice request for oceanic clearance on the Shanwick delivery frequency is as follows: Shanwick, KLM 467 estimating LIMRI at 1235z request mach .81, FL360, able FL380. WebbShanwick Radio uses over 20 HF and 2 VHF frequency channels. At peak times, it handles in excess of 1,500 aircraft in a 24 hour period.
